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from La Ciotat to Uzès is to line 79 bus and bus which costs €21 - €35 and takes 5h 29m.
The fastest way to get from La Ciotat to Uzès is to drive which takes 1h 57m and costs €25 - €40.
No, there is no direct bus from La Ciotat to Uzès. However, there are services departing from Office de Tourisme and arriving at UZÈS - Esplanade via Marseille - Saint-Charles Bus Station, Parnasse and NÎMES - Gare Routière.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 29m.
The distance between La Ciotat and Uzès is 193 km. The road distance is 167.9 km.
The best way to get from La Ciotat to Uzès without a car is to train and line 152 bus which takes 4h 16m and costs €24 - €85.
It takes approximately 4h 16m to get from La Ciotat to Uzès, including transfers.
